  • What if I have a caesarean section?
    If you've had or will have a caesarean section, we can typically start the postpartum massage 5-7 days after delivery, depending on how your body is recovering. During the first few sessions, we will avoid touching your abdomen. The timing may vary based on your doctor's advice or depending on your individual circumstances.

  • What do I need to prepare at my home for Prenatal Massage?
    To prepare for your prenatal massage at home, you'll need the following items: An old bedsheet to put over your bed Two hand towels Two small pillows to support your body We will bring all other necessary items, such as herbal oils and portable massage beds (if needed).
